Who is Vulnerable?
Vulnerability Description Multiple buffer overflow vulnerabilities has been reported in EMC AlphaStor Library Control Program (LCP) while parsing remote requests. The vulnerabilities are due to missing bounds check while copying request data into fixed length stack buffers. An unauthenticated attackers can exploit this vulnerability to execute arbitrary code in the security context of the Library Manager process, which is System on Windows platforms. Successful exploitation could result in a denial of service condition or arbitrary code execution on the targeted system.
